Launching on 6th May 2011 at the Fiction Express site, run by children’s publisher Discovery Books, are four e-books targeted at young readers. Each novel will give readers options to vote and decide what happens next in the plot.
New episodes are available online every Friday at 3.30pm and readers have until 10.00am the following Monday to cast a vote. Authors then write a new chapter according to the most popular reader choice. This continues for a total of eleven weeks.
The four novels are:
Diary of a Mall Girl by Luisa Plaja (Split by a Kiss, etc - and the editor of this site!)
The Soterion Mission by Stewart Ross (Timewarp Trials and What if the Bomb Goes Off?)
Soul Shadows by Alex Woolf (The Chronosphere)
The Last Symbol by Rebecca Morton
Fiction Express also gives readers the opportunity to submit their own ideas for incorporation into the plot, and there will be competitions for readers to become a part of the story itself.
The first chapter of each book is available free of charge, and later chapters sell from 59p.
